Loretta died Sunday, Jan. 9, 2011, at the Eureka Assisted Living Center.
Loretta F. Miller, daughter of William and Marie (Ritter) Miller, was born Feb. 29, 1920, on the family homestead northeast of Eureka. Her parents died when she and her siblings were very young. The children were divided up to live with uncles and aunts. She attended rural school and, as a young woman, she moved to Seattle, Wash., during World War II to work in the shipyard. She worked as a welder building ships. She later moved to California.
She was united in marriage to Clarence Pete Hylton on July 26, 1954, in California. She worked in food service in various delicatessens in the Los Angeles area. Her husband died in 1988. In 2002, she moved back to Eureka.
Loretta loved crossword puzzles, reading, and completing jigsaw puzzles.
She attended St. Paul's United Church of Christ in Eureka.
Survivors include her nieces and nephews and one sister-in-law, Annie Miller of Baker, Mont.
Her parents, husband, two brothers - Harold and Eugene - one infant sister, Olivia, and two sisters - Lillian Kessler and Tillie Gradberg - preceded her in death.
